“…However, patients will receive additional radiation due to repeated exposures, especially for long treatment procedures. The Calypso 4D localization system (Calypso Medical Technologies, Seattle, WA) uses miniaturized, nonionizing implanted fiducial devices, 16 , 17 , 18 which are electromagnetic transponders, called Beacons, to set up the patient efficiently and to track the location of the treatment target during external beam radiotherapy. This will allow for accurate localization of the treatment target both before and during the treatment, and real‐time tracking of the target during treatment.…”

“…It will be more useful to know what percentage of a regular patient population will exhibit such large prostate motion and benefit from real‐time motion tracking. Based on the results of 35 patients, Kupelian et al (18) reported that approximately 15% of fractions (83% of patients) exhibited a 5 mm shift for cumulative 30 s. However, detailed analyses showed that the majority of patients did not exhibit substantial prostate movements in any fractions, while some patients had up to 56% of fractions with >5mm shifts for >30s. It will be clinically important to identify such patients with substantial prostate movements and design “personalized” treatment strategies for them.…”

“…Prostate position during treatment can be monitored using a variety of methods, including megavoltage (MV) imaging,1 ultrasound,2 Calypso electromagnetic guidance,3 the BrainLAB ExacTrac x‐ray system,4 the Cyberknife platform,5, 6, 7 and Navotek radioactive fiducials 8. Adjustments to either the patient or the beam position can then be made during treatment to correct for the motion observed.…”
